Kanye West ordered to pay $140K in Malibu mansion renovation lawsuit
A handyman had sought $1.7m (£1.267m) from the rapper over claims of unpaid work, medical expenses and being unfairly fired.

A jury found Ye, formerly known as Kanye West, liable in a legal dispute brought by his former contractor, Tony Saxon, and ordered him to pay $140,000. Saxon had sued for unpaid wages, medical expenses, and wrongful termination related to renovations at West's Malibu mansion.
A Los Angeles jury ordered Ye to pay $140,000 to Tony Saxon, who alleged unpaid wages and unsafe working conditions during renovations at West's Malibu mansion. The jury also awarded Saxon attorney fees, expected to total over $1 million.
